				<description><![CDATA[ <b>Essential units</b><br /> <br /> Crisis Commander<br /> Crisis Suits (Elites)<br /> Fire Warriors<br /> Kroot<br /> Hammerhead/Railgun<br /> <br /> <br /> <b>Tau Optional Units</b><br /> <br /> Broadsides (good anti-tank, lets the Railgun concentrate on lobbing blasts.)<br /> Gun Drone Squadrons<br /> Stealth Suits (not as good as they used to be)<br /> Devilfish (can upgrade the weapons with <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(388);'>SMS</span> but they get expensive.)<br /> Pathfinders<br /> Stingray<br /> Piranhas<br /> <br /> <br /> <b>Useless Units</b><br /> <br /> Sniper Drones (overcosted and waste a heavy slot)<br /> Vespids<br /> Space Pope<br /> Ethereals generally (some people like them)<br /> <br /> All just my opinion.]]></description>

				<description><![CDATA[ You'll have to bump that xv8 to a shas'vre to get an AFP. . . <br /> <br /> Rail rifles are cool, but it sucks to have to drop to just 3 markerlights. . . if you've got an extra heavy support and you're set on rail rifle syou might want to consider sniper drones to carry them. . . <br /> <br /> That way, you could put them well away from the fray and use them to screen pathfinders - the <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(105);'>PFs</span> get a coversave, but markerlights never grant the enemy a save when firing through cover.<br /> <br /> I've never tried it,  but it sounds ok.]]></description>
